New Issue: Virginia Journal of International Law

The latest issue of the Virginia Journal of International Law (Vol. 52, no. 3, Spring 2012) is out. Contents include:
  • Ashley S. Deeks, “Unwilling or Unable”: Toward a Normative Framework for Extraterritorial Self-Defense
  • Alvaro Santos, Carving Out Policy Autonomy for Developing Countries in the World Trade Organization: The Experience of Brazil & Mexico
  • Andrew K. Woods, Moral Judgments & International Crimes: The Disutility of Desert
  • David Zaring, Finding Legal Principle in Global Financial Regulation
  • Jason Webb Yackee, Investment Treaties & Investor Corruption: An Emerging Defense for Host States
